I loved making this card - I had a really good play with sponging, masking, colouring and cutting out.

And here it is


I used up some of my retired DSP for this card as it had some lovely snowflakes on and I sponged the edges with Night of Navy ink.
My middle panel is sponged to represent a snowy landscape with the foxes sleeping in their underground hole.
The foxes are from the Wildly Happy stamp set and I water coloured them with Crajun Craze ink.
